Every three years, with the release of the Federal Reserve’s 2013 Survey of Consumer Finances (SCF), we update our National Retirement Risk Index (NRRI). The NRRI shows the share of working-age households who are “at risk” of being unable to maintain their pre-retirement standard of living in retirement. Last week’s blog post reported that – according to the Federal Reserve’s 2013 Survey of Consumer Finances – 401(k)/IRA balances for the typical working household approaching retirement declined from $120,000 in 2010 to $111,000 in 2013.
